Day 88: Invasion

I have often wondered if one day Spain would ever invade Gibraltar and seize it back from British Colonial rule.

Today, however, the roles were reversed. Spain and Gibraltar opened their border so that not just Spanish residents could cross, as has been the case till now.

Within minutes of the announcement, hordes of Gibraltarians raced for the frontier to experience their first moments of freedom in nearly three months. As you can see from the extra, the queue to pass into Spain grew from virtually nothing in moments.

I can't say I blame them. I wouldn't like to be cooped up there for more than a day, let alone 88.
